How long do Wolverine boots take to break in?

How long do Wolverine boots take to break in?

New boots can take around 80 to 100 hours to break in. That being said, don’t subject yourself to wearing your boots for 4 days straight and expect your feet to be happy with you. Instead, space this time out to about 2 to 3 hours a day and keep a second pair of boots to change into.

Where are Wolverine 1000 Mile boots made?

Rockford, Michigan
Product Description. The original 1000 mile boot is recreated from an archival Wolverine pattern and is America’s original work boot. Designed in Rockford, Michigan and handcrafted in the USA, each pair is made with meticulous attention to detail and built to last.

How long should Wolverine boots last?

Wolverine is made of high-quality and durable material. Depending on your work area, the boot can last for about 3 to 10 years and more. If great care is taken on the boot, it will last up to 10 plus years. If you get the bottom worn out, you can resole.

Where are Wolverine Boots made?

Some of Wolverine’s boots are made in Michigan and other Wolverine plants across the USA. For example, the limited edition Ramparts are made at a Wolverine factory in Tennessee with the leather material sourced from Chicago.

What is the history of winwolverine boots?

Wolverine was founded in Michigan by G.A.Krause, who believed in the opportunity for business in America. The story started in 1883 when he opened a small leather tannery with just a few employees.
